My computer build which I completed today goes as follows

i5 3570k
Asus P8Z77-V LE Plus
EVGA 650 ti boost Superclocked
Seagate barracuda 750 Gb sata hdd
WD caviar SE 250gb hdd
Random optical drive
NZXT Phantom Full Tower Chassis
600w corsair builder psu
16gb corsair vengeance ram

I plugged everything in and turned on the psu, I pushed the power button on the case, all the fan leds turned on and started spinning for about a second and then turns off please help!!!! I have no idea what is wrong, I think it might be a weak psu. Opinions?

More about : wrong computer build

June 22, 2013 9:36:57 AM

PSU is fine. Make sure your Memory is seated properly, also remove the CPU and check the pins in the socket and make sure there are no bent ones, if the memory is seated.

Best solution

June 22, 2013 10:55:54 AM

OK. Recheck all the PSU connections to the MOtherboard and make sure they are snugly plugged in, especially the 8 pin CPU connector and 24 pin ATX Connector.

Thank you, I forgot to plug in the 8 pin CPU connector, facepalm: (
